Kangaroos cause chaos at the top of AFL draft after surprise selection of Will Phillips – Wide World of Sports
‘I had no idea’

He was widely tipped to not be swept up until pick six, but North Melbourne have nabbed midfield bull Will Phillips with pick three in a move that’s stunned the footy world.
Most credible phantom drafts had projected Phillips to be the sixth selection, with Jamarra Ugle-Hagan, Riley Thilthorpe, Logan McDonald, Elijah Hollands and Denver Grainger-Barras all forecast to be snapped up earlier.
